Таблица размещения слов с пробелами на разных строках - PullRequest
4 голосов
/ 02 октября 2010

Я пытаюсь сделать таблицу в HTML.Когда я изменяю размер окна, чтобы оно стало узким, и оно пытается сжать все, чтобы поместиться в окне, даже если оно узкое, оно помещает содержимое ячейки в разные строки.Я не хочу, чтобы это случилось.Например:

home    about    contact us

при сужении окна браузера:

home    about    contact
                 us

Это действительно раздражает.Я попытался поместить   вместо пробела, где это пробел, но это не помогло.Кто-нибудь знает решение?

Ответы [ 4 ]

1 голос
/ 02 октября 2010

Попробуйте добавить атрибут CSS пробела в элементы <td> таблицы.В частности <td style='white-space: no-wrap;'>

1 голос
/ 02 октября 2010

Вы можете использовать &nbsp; для этого.Таким образом, браузер видит это как одно слово.

0 голосов
/ 02 октября 2010

Что вы ожидаете?

Скажем, окно становится меньше, так что ячейка также становится меньше, чем для полного размещения contact us, тогда ожидаете ли вы, что «дополнительный» контент будет скрыт? Размер ячейки никогда не станет меньше фиксированного минимума?

Вам необходимо использовать width ad height вместе с overflow ( overflow ). overflow:hidden скроет содержимое, которое больше width (при условии, что height задано)

0 голосов
/ 02 октября 2010
td { white-space:nowrap; }
...